What's Happening?
Pink, the Grammy-winning musician, has publicly refuted rumors that she and her husband, Carey Hart, are divorcing. The rumors surfaced after People magazine reported that the couple was separating for a second time after 20 years of marriage. Pink addressed
these claims on social media, labeling them as 'fake news' and expressing surprise at the reports. She humorously noted that her children were also unaware of any separation. The rumors coincided with Pink's nomination for the 2026 Rock & Roll Hall of Fame, an achievement she highlighted in her response. Pink and Hart, who married in 2006 and briefly separated in 2008, have two children together.
